Man arrested over death of British woman found in suitcase in Athens
The body of Scottish national Elisabeth-Jane Ross was discovered last month in a suitcase in a derelict building in Athens. A 26-year-old man has been arrested by Greek police in connection with the death of a British woman whose body was found in a suitcase in Athens last month. "Officers of the Directorate for Combating Organized Crime have solved the homicide of a 38-year-old UK national, whose body was found inside a suitcase in an abandoned building in the Kypseli area on July 18," the Hellenic Police said on Sunday. The victim, identified in British and Greek media reports as 38-year-old Elisabeth-Jane Ross from Scotland, arrived in Greece in late June and was last known to be in the Athens area on July 10. She was later reported missing. Police said the suspect, a foreign national, confessed on Thursday and now faces charges including intentional homicide, robbery and firearms-related offenses. "It emerged that the [suspect] placed the body in a suitcase and transported it to the abandoned premises.
